|
@@ -894,11 +894,12 @@ void omap_start_dma(int lch)
|
|
|
int next_lch, cur_lch;
|
|
|
char dma_chan_link_map[MAX_LOGICAL_DMA_CH_COUNT];
|
|
|
|
|
|
- dma_chan_link_map[lch] = 1;
|
|
|
/* Set the link register of the first channel */
|
|
|
enable_lnk(lch);
|
|
|
|
|
|
memset(dma_chan_link_map, 0, sizeof(dma_chan_link_map));
|
|
|
+ dma_chan_link_map[lch] = 1;
|
|
|
+
|
|
|
cur_lch = dma_chan[lch].next_lch;
|
|
|
do {
|
|
|
next_lch = dma_chan[cur_lch].next_lch;
|